Pragmatic Play is a relatively young gambling software provider that appeared on the market in 2015. However, it has managed to gain an impressive foothold in the industry, outperforming many long-established companies.

Pragmatic’s games are designed primarily using HTML5 and run smoothly on Windows, Android, and Apple mobile devices. They also feature a convenient interface that can be used in landscape mode, which allows players to enjoy a more customized gameplay.

The company’s library includes a wide range of casino games, including a variety of video poker titles. In addition to classic slot machines, Pragmatic Play’s portfolio features a number of innovative titles that offer unique themes, engaging gameplay, and high average RTPs.

In the slot genre, the company offers games that feature modern graphics and immersive gameplay, such as Wolf Gold, which is set on the desert plains of North America, where wolves, bison, panthers, and bald eagles roam the land and predators live or die by the simple rule of “eat or be eaten.”

All Pragmatic Play’s casino games are tested for fairness by independent third parties. In addition, the company’s gaming content has been certified by a variety of reputable testing laboratories, including QUINEL, BMM, and Gaming Labs. The company’s dedication to working in regulated markets has made it one of the most respected suppliers of casino content today.
